Read More: PSC Press Release HSBC Divestment from Elbit – Arms Trade Public Meeting 17 JanBelow is the press release from PSC regarding HSBC’s divestment from Elbit Systems. Manchester PSC next public meeting is with Huda Ammori, Palestinian activist and PSC campaigns officer. Before moving to PSC national office,she was a BDS campaigner at Manchester University.
